We all know Pitt is expensive. We all talk about how much debt we'll have when we leave, usually as a joke, but we're all serious. Why did I come here? Was it worth it? I'm here to tell you that despite the sum on that bill after college, Pitt is worth it!

Pitt has some amazing academic opportunities; we know that. However, it is the things outside of the classroom that really give Pitt its value.

1. Lifestyle options

Not only does Pitt have a multitude of gyms, but they also have fitness classes you can take for credit or for free. Recently, they added free classes to teach safety and prevent sexual assault. Name me another school that has Badminton, Pilates and Party Dance fitness classes. Even the counseling and health center can't be taken for granted because other schools don't have one or both. Perhaps most important to your lifestyle is eating. Pittsburgh has a number of restaurants and stores that cater to every type of diet, from gluten-free and vegan to hungry football player. At a smaller school, or maybe one in the middle of nowhere, it would be much harder to find so many diverse options. And by options, I mean, there is some pretty awesome food in Pittsburgh. If you don't want to leave, there is always Market.

2. Free and almost free stuff

Perhaps the best thing at Pitt is the free stuff! I'm not just talking about T-shirts and pizza, I mean the awesome opportunities we have for free. Walk the Moon concert – it was free. Bill Nye lecture – it was free. Phipps – it's free. Carnegie Museum – it's free. Ballets and musicals downtown – they can be free. Basketball and football tickets – lets face it, compared to other schools, they're basically free. Other schools either A) don't have this kind of stuff or B) you have to pay for all of it. Pirates tickets are so cheap for an MLB team, and PNC Park is one of the best ballparks in America. Student rush for Pens games gets you some of the cheapest tickets in the NHL. If you're paying that much to be here, why not take advantage of all the extra stuff you can't do anywhere else? There is literally always something free to do on campus or just a short bus ride away.

3. The experience

The experiences you can have at Pitt are unlike many other schools. Just this past month, all of the major presidential candidates and the Vice President visited Pittsburgh. Very few other schools have that opportunity. We have a bus pass at our fingertips; you can explore this entire city if you take advantage of it. There are almost 500 student organizations on campus! That is 500 things to possibly get involved in. The leadership opportunities and chances to make real change here are abundant if you take Pitt for everything it has to offer. The people here are pretty great, too, and you'll always have a friend in Cathy.

Pitt is expensive, but if you take advantage of everything this university and city has, you'll realize Pitt is worth it because you can't get this experience anywhere else.
